Bel Fullana (Mallorca, 1985) holds a BFA from the University of Barcelona’s Faculty of Fine Arts, Sant Jordi.
She has presented solo exhibitions at institutions and galleries including Es Baluard Museu d’Art Modern i Contemporani de Palma (Mallorca), PIERMARQ* (Sydney), Freight + Volume (New York), Allouche Benias Gallery (Athens), Galería Fran Reus (Mallorca), Arts+Leisure (New York), Espacio Dörffi (Lanzarote), Galería Herrero de Tejada (Madrid), L21 Gallery (Mallorca and Madrid), Kubik Gallery (Porto), and the Vitrine space at Kunsthalle São Paulo.
Her work has been featured in numerous international art fairs, including Untitled Art Miami Beach, Kiaf Seoul, ARCOmadrid, Zona Maco, Ch.ACO, Sunday Art Fair, Art Rotterdam, Art Copenhagen, Art Herning, Enter Art Fair, CAN Art Ibiza, and Urvanity Art Fair.
Her work has also been included in curated group exhibitions at Sala de Arte Joven de la Comunidad de Madrid, Museu d’Art Contemporani d’Eivissa (MACE Ibiza), Es Baluard Museu d’Art Modern i Contemporani de Palma, and Casal Solleric.
In 2017, she received the Premi Ciutat de Palma d’Arts Visuals. She has also participated in international artist residencies, including DNA Summer Residency (2018) and PANAL 361 (2014).
Her work is held in both public and private collections, including Fundació Es Baluard Museu (Palma de Mallorca), Casa MER Collection (Segovia), Marquez Art Projects (Miami), Colección Mecenas, and the LH Private Collection (Marseille).
